How color accurate is Huion Kamvas 24 Plus?

Published in Digital Art Displays 4 mins read

The Huion Kamvas 24 Plus is highly color accurate, boasting an impressive 140% sRGB color gamut enhanced by quantum dot technology, which ensures a vibrant and precise visual experience ideal for professional creative work.


Exceptional Color Gamut and Quantum Dot Technology

The core of the Huion Kamvas 24 Plus's color accuracy lies in its advanced display technology. It incorporates quantum dot technology, a cutting-edge feature that significantly improves color performance. This allows the display to achieve a remarkable 140% sRGB color gamut. A wider color gamut means the display can reproduce a much broader spectrum of colors than standard displays, leading to richer, more vibrant, and true-to-life images.

Quantum dots are microscopic semiconductor crystals that emit pure monochromatic light when energy is applied. This results in purer, more saturated colors, higher brightness, and improved energy efficiency compared to traditional LED backlights. For artists and designers, this translates directly into a more faithful representation of their digital artwork on screen.

Vivid Details with 2.5K QHD Resolution

Beyond its expansive color gamut, the Kamvas 24 Plus features a 2.5K QHD (2560 x 1440) resolution. This high resolution ensures that all colors are presented with incredible clarity and detail. Higher pixel density allows for smoother gradients, sharper lines, and the ability to discern fine nuances in color, making the overall visual experience exceptionally lively and precise. This combination of wide color gamut and high resolution is crucial for tasks requiring meticulous color management and intricate detail.

What Does 140% sRGB Mean for Creatives?

A 140% sRGB color gamut is a significant advantage for anyone working with visual media. While sRGB is the most common color space for web content and consumer devices, exceeding 100% sRGB indicates that the display can reproduce colors beyond the standard sRGB space, closer to professional color spaces like Adobe RGB. This offers several key benefits:

  • Wider Color Palette: Access to a broader range of hues and saturations, allowing artists to create and view their work with more subtle color variations.
  • Accurate Previews: Ensures that what you see on your drawing tablet is very close to the final output, reducing surprises when printing or publishing.
  • Enhanced Detail: Richer color information can reveal more detail in shadows and highlights, which is critical for complex illustrations and photo editing.
  • Professional Reliability: Provides the confidence that your color choices are consistent and accurate across different stages of your workflow.

Understanding Color Accuracy Metrics Beyond Gamut

While a wide color gamut like 140% sRGB is excellent, true color accuracy also depends on other metrics, such as Delta E (ΔE). Delta E measures the difference between a displayed color and its actual intended color.

  • A Delta E value of less than 2 is generally considered excellent and virtually imperceptible to the human eye, making it ideal for professional color-critical work.
  • Values between 2 and 4 are still very good for most creative tasks.

Although specific ΔE values for the Kamvas 24 Plus are not provided in the primary information, devices boasting such a wide color gamut and quantum dot technology are typically calibrated to achieve low Delta E values, further solidifying their color performance. For optimal results, regular calibration with a colorimeter is recommended to maintain peak accuracy over time.
